Orbi RBK50 - issues with Skype and other remote video services

Is anyone else having issues with Skype, Teams, Zoom, etc. running very poorly with the Orbi Mesh Routers? With the stay-at-home measures over the last month, I've noticed frequent issues with poor bandwidth, pixelation, garbled voices, etc.

 

I realize there are about 1,000 different troubleshooting issues, and I won't detail everything I've done. But suffice it to say, I don't have speed issues with any other apps, I have a 100 Mbps+ connection to Comcast, and the quality of my line (jitter, SNR, etc.) is fine. I've also tried the Port Triggering options for these services to no avail.

 

I'm happy to entertain suggestions for troubleshooting, but mostly I'm looking to see if issues with Skype, etc. are a known issue with the current firmware (2.5.1.8). I've tried downgrading to an earlier firmware and re-upgrading, and that hasn't really fixed anything.

Re: Orbi RBK50 - issues with Skype and other remote video services

What is the Mfr and model# of the ISP modem/ONT the NG router is connected too?

Are the problems see over wired and wireless connections? 

 

What is the size of your home? Sq Ft?
What is the distance between the router and satellite(s)? 30 feet is recommended in between RBR and RBS to begin with depending upon building materials when wirelessly connected. https://kb.netgear.com/000036466/How-far-should-I-place-my-Orbi-satellite-from-my-Orbi-router

 

What channels are you using? Auto? Try setting manual channel 1, 6 or 11 on 2.4Ghz and any unused channel on 5Ghz.
Any Wifi Neighbors near by? If so, how many?

 

Try enabling Beamforming and MIMO(MIMO may or maynot be needed) and WMM. Under Advanced Tab/Advanced Settings/Wireless Settings

Try disabling the following and see:
Armor, Circle, Daisy Chain, Fast Roaming, IPv6 and Set 20/40Mhz Coexistence to 40Mhz only. Set Short preamble instead of Long preamble modes. Save settings and reboot the router and satellite(s).

 

Please try a factory reset and setup from scratch with the RBR and RBS.
